Easing The Workforce Regulations with a EOR
Venturing into the Bharat's market as a foreign company presents distinct challenges, particularly when it comes to labor law obeyance. Deciphering the complexities of Regional ordinances, Provident Fund contributions, Employee State Insurance, and various other requirements can be daunting. Employing an Employer of Record (EOR) offers a effective solution. They function as your official boss on paper, guaranteeing full compliance with all applicable Indian laws and processing payroll, benefits, and revenue obligations. This allows your organization to focus on its core operations, lessen risks associated with misinterpretations or infringements, and expedite your market entry into a dynamic economy. Furthermore, an EOR can often provide valuable expertise on best practices and ensure your employees is treated fairly and legally.
